Abstract

AbstractThis study aims to identify comic-based learning media in an effort to increase students interest and learning outcomes in hydrostatic pressure material. This study uses the use of a technology-based application called Pixtoon that researchers use to develop the creation of science learning comilk on hydrostatic pressure material in class VIII A1 SMP Negeri 4 Selakau. In the learning process, researchers applied a cooperative learning model with nht (numbered head together) type. Based on the analysis of data, it concluded that the tests developed are worth using to improve the learning outcomes of learners, namely: 1) have a higher validity than the validity of the table, 2) The average results of the student questionnaire before using comic learning media is 1.84. And the average result after using comic learning media is 3.40, so it can be stated that the interest of learners in comic-based learning can increase the learning interest of learners.. 3) pretest value reached 21.18 while postest reached 72.94 so that the difference score was 51.76, 4) the result of the response of students to comic-based learning media is 3.09 with the category "very good", 5) the effectiveness of media feasibility value is 3.23 with high criteria. So that this comicbased learning media is worth using and effective to increase the interest and learning outcomes of learners.Keywords: learning media, hydrostatic pressure, comic

Abstract

Abstract This study aimed to asses the effectiveness of Guided Inquiry Learning Model with Mind Mapping to remediate student’s misconception on ‘work’ for grade X IPA student of SMA Negeri 3 Pontianak.. The method used in this research was preexperimental method with the one-group pretest-posttest design. Samples of study were purposive sampling and selected base on Physics teacher’s recommendation. The instrument of research included 10 questions of diagnostic test. The average range of students misconception in pre test was 82,94% and in post test was 30% . The average range decreased 64,36% after the treatment. Based on McNemar test, overall students experienced significant misconception with value of χ2 count (82,51) > χ 2 table (3,84), df=1 and α = 5%. The effectiveness of Guided Inquiry Learning Model with Mind Mapping to remediate student’s misconception about ‘work’ that used to reduce the misconcepted students through DQM of 64,37% which included in medium category. Therefore, teachers suggested to used Guided Inquiry Learning Model as alternative learning technique in order to straighten out student misconception in the material ‘work’. Keywords: Guided Inquiry, Mind Mapping, Remediation.

Abstract

AbstractThis study aims to determine the effectiveness of the implementation of interactive conceptual instruction (ICI) models to increase the learning outcomes of the elasticity's material of students in class XI MIA SMA Negeri 5 Pontianak. This reseacrh method is quasi-experimental with non-equivalent control group design. Intact group purposive sampling used in this research with 34 students of XI MIA 2 as experiment class and 35 students of XI MIA 1 as control class. 7 items are used as instrument with each test before and after treatment. Based on the results of analysis an increase in the learning outcomes of control class students by 0.29 (low) and the experimental class by 0.60 (moderate). The results of  calculation of the experimental class gain and control class obtained sig.(2 tailed) of 0,000 < 0,05 it can be concluded that there is a significant differences in student learning outcomes improvement using the ICI model and the effectiveness of using the ICI model is categorized as high with effect size 3.30 (high category). Based on these results show that the impelementation of the ICI model is effective in improving students learning outcomes the material elasticity in SMA Negeri 5 Pontianak.Keywords :  Effectiveness, Elasticity, Improved Learning Outcomes, Interactive Conceptual Instruction.

Abstract

AbstractThis study aims to asses the effectiveness of integrated remediation of misconception with problem solving model in reducing student misconception and improving learning result related to Archimedes Law at VIII grade of SMP Negeri 3 Sungai Raya. Pre-experimental method with the design of pretest-posttest was used in this paper. Samples of study were determined by using intact group and selected by science teachers recommendation. The instrument of research included 8 questions of diagnostic test and 4 questions of learning result test. The percentage of misconcepted students in every concept and in every student dropped to 72,94% and 74,07%, respectively. Based on McNemar test, overall students experienced significant misconception with value of ?2count (131,16) > ?2table (3,84), df=1 and ? = 5%. Students learning results which were analyzed with N-Gain equation revealed a moderate increase at 0,6. The effectiveness that used to reduce the misconcepted students through DQM of 72,94% which included in high category. Keywords: Problem Solving Model, Integrated Remediation Misconception, Archimedes Law

Abstract

AbstractThis study aims to improve student learning outcomes on elasticity and Hooke's law by applying the learning cycle learning 7E model. The design of this study was in the form of a quasi-experimental design with a nonequivalent control group design. This study involved students of class XI MIA 3 and class XI MIA 4 in SMA Negeri 6 Pontianak, who were selected using a random sampling method with an intact group. Data collection tools used in the form of a test form consisting of 5 questions with a reliability level of 0.56. Based on the results of the Mann Whitney U test obtained Zcount by -4.71 and Ztable by -1.96 (-1.96 > -4.71). Thus there are differences in student learning outcomes between the group taught with the applied model, and the group taught with the conventional learning model. The effectiveness of the applied learning model was calculated using the Cohen effect size formula with the result of 1.53 and a high category. Therefore, it can be concluded that the application of the learning cycle 7E model can improve student learning outcomes on the material of elasticity and Hooke's law. Keywords: Elasticity & Hooke’s Law, Learning Cycle 7E model, Learning Outcomes.

Abstract

AbstractThis study aimed to assess the effectiveness of misconception remediation using predict, discuss, explain, observe, discuss, explain (PDEODE) strategies on momentum and impulse of students at SMAN 1 Selimbau. The method used in this research was a pre-experimental design with one group pre-test post-test design. Samples of study were intact group and selected based on physics teacher’s recommendation. The research instrument included 8 questions of diagnostic test. The percentage number of students with misconceptions of each indicator and student was reduced to 69,38% and 71,80%. Based on the results of the McNemar test, overall students experienced significant conceptual changes with a value of X 2 count(67.37)> χ 2 table (3.84) with df = 1 and α = 5%. The effectiveness using PDEODE strategies to remediate the number of student’s misconception through DQM of 68,98% which is included to medium category. This research is suggested to be use as an alternative learning activity to reduce the number of students that have misconception on momentum and impulse.Keywords: Misconception Remediation, Momentum and Impuls, Predict, Discuss, Explain, Observe, Discuss, Explain (PDEODE)

Abstract

AbstractThis research aims to reveal the profile, the percentage and to find out the causes of students’ difficulties in solving about rotational dynamics and statistic equilibrium. This Research conducted at MAN 2 Pontianak which subjects are 5 out of 20 students who were given the test. Data collected by giving the HOTS essay questions and interviews. The analysis data technic was Miles and Huberman. The results show that students' difficulties are divided into 5 according to the Heller problem solving stages. (1) The difficulty of visualizing the problems by students was 63.75%. Because they do not know how to draw a sketch on each question. (2) The difficulty of physics description by students was 21.25 %. Because they do not understand the problems given to the questions. (3) The difficulty of making the plan solution was 58,75%. Because they do not understand the concepts used in the questions. (4) The difficulty of executing the plan was 71,25%. Because they do not know the concepts used in the questions and do not understand the arithmetic operations. (5) The difficulty of checking and evaluating was 78,75%. Because they are not careful in checking the answers and being hurry to finish the questionsKeywords: Analysis Difficulty, Problem Solving HOTS, Rotational Dynamics and Statistic Equilibrium
